Trust in Yellow - Who are we?

Posted by Trust in Yellow on April 23, 2007 2:17 AM | 

trustlogosmall.gif

Trust in Yellow was formed on the 26th April 2006 by a group of supporters’ of Southport Football Club disgruntled by a lack of supporter involvement and a growing rift between the board of directors and its’ supporters. During the six months which preceded the group had spent time carefully constructing working relationships with the supporters, board of directors, playing staff and media. Whilst wholly independent Trust in Yellow works closely with Southport Football Club to achieve their individual and respective objectives.

Trust in Yellow is a member of supporters direct a body funded by Sport England. There are over 140 supporters’ trusts under the supporters’ direct jurisdiction. The trust is an industrial and provident society, and is regulated by its’ own written constitution.

The trust gained its’ name having asked supporters to suggest a suitable title for their organization. Subsequently, TIY, asked match-goers and exiles via the internet, to vote on their preferred name from a shortlist, prior to the game against Canvey Island on February 6th 2006. Over 400 Participants voted, the leader - Trust in Yellow. The trust logo was also selected by supporters, following on from a competition within the local schools, the logo above was chosen designed by James Dorman of Ainsdale Hope. This represents Trust in Yellows’ desire to work closely with its’ supporters and the local community.

To date Trust in Yellow has acquired 342 members and formerly elected a committee of 12 in November 2006. Co-opting a 13th member shortly afterwards.

The trust also hopes to open its’ own office in the close season where members can purchase/renew memberships, book a place on a coach or acquire merchandise and air their views.

This is just the beginning for Trust in Yellow a long term, supporter led objective, aimed at increasing supporters’ involvement in their football club.
